Seed-Coder: Let the Code Model Curate Data for Itself

🌐 Homepage   |   🤗 Hugging Face   |   📄 arXiv

We are thrilled to introduce Seed-Coder (previously known as Doubao-Coder), a family of lightweight yet powerful open-source code LLMs comprising base, instruct and reasoning models of 8B size.

Seed-Coder demonstrates that, with minimal human effort, LLMs can effectively curate code training data by themselves to drastically enhance coding capabilities.

Seed-Coder represents our initial step towards contributing to the open-source LLM ecosystem. We look forward to seeing Seed-Coder drive advances in code intelligence and empower broader applications in the open-source LLM community!

🌟 Highlights

  • Model-centric: Seed-Coder predominantly leverages LLMs instead of hand-crafted rules for code data filtering, minimizing manual effort in pretraining data construction.

  • Transparent: We openly share detailed insights into our model-centric data pipeline, including methods for curating GitHub data, commits data, and code-related web data.

  • Powerful: Seed-Coder achieves state-of-the-art performance among open-source models of comparable size across a diverse range of coding tasks.

⚡ Quick Start

We are excited to introduce Seed-Coder, featuring three powerful models:

Model Name Length Download Notes
Seed-Coder-8B-Base 32K 🤗 Model Pretrained on our model-centric code data.
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ct 32K 🤗 Model Instruction-tuned for alignment with user intent.
Seed-Coder-8B-Reasoning 64K 🤗 Model RL trained to boost reasoning capabilities.
Seed-Coder-8B-Reasoning-bf16 64K 🤗 Model RL trained to boost reasoning capabilities.

All the models are publicly available on Hugging Face collection.

👉🏻 Deploying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ct with transformers

from transformers import AutoTokenizer, AutoModelForCausalLM
import torch

model_id = "ByteDance-Seed/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ct"

t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ained(model_id, trust_remote_code=True)
model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ained(model_id, torch_dtype=torch.bfloat16, device_map="auto", trust_remote_code=True)

messages = [
    {"role": "user", "content": "Write a quick sort algorithm."},
]

input_ids = tokenizer.apply_chat_template(
    messages,
    tokenize=True,
    return_tensors="pt",
    add_generation_prompt=True,  
).to(model.device)

outputs = model.generate(input_ids, max_new_tokens=512)
response = tokenizer.decode(outputs[0][input_ids.shape[-1]:], skip_special_tokens=True)
print(response)

For more detailed usage instructions and model-specific configurations, please refer to the Hugging Face model pages linked above.

👉🏻 Deploying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ct with vLLM

As part of the new generation of code models,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ct is fully supported by vLLM. A detailed tutorial can be found in the vLLM documentation.

Here, we provide a simple example for offline batched inference using vLLM.

Offline Batched Inference

from transformers import AutoTokenizer
from vllm import LLM, SamplingParams
# Initialize the tokenizer
t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ained("ByteDance-Seed/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ct")

# Pass the default decoding hyperparameters of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ct
# max_tokens is for the maximum length for generation.
sampling_params = SamplingParams(temperature=0.6, top_p=0.8, repetition_penalty=1.05, max_tokens=512)

# Input the model name or path. Can be GPTQ or AWQ models.
llm = LLM(model="ByteDance-Seed/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ct")

# Prepare your prompts
prompt = "#write a quick sort algorithm."

# generate outputs
outputs = llm.generate([prompt], sampling_params)

# Print the outputs.
for output in outputs:
    prompt = output.prompt
    generated_text = output.outputs[0].text
    print(f"Prompt: {prompt!r}\n\nGenerated content: {generated_text!r}")

Multi-GPU Distributed Serving

To further boost the serving throughput, distributed inference is supported by leveraging multiple GPU devices.

When handling long-context inputs (up to 32K tokens), tensor parallelism can help mitigate GPU memory limitations.

Here is how to run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ct with tensor parallelism:

llm = LLM(model="ByteDance-Seed/Seed-Coder-8B-Instruct", tensor_parallel_size=8)

🏆 Performance

We evaluated Seed-Coder across a wide range of coding benchmarks, including code generation, code completion, code editing, code reasoning, and software engineering tasks.

Seed-Coder achieves state-of-the-art performance among open-source models at the 8B scale, and even surpasses some much larger models.

For detailed benchmark results and analysis, please refer to our Technical Report.
